      SE Symbolizer version 1.1.0 (2006-07-20)
    
	
	
	
		
			
        A "SymbolizerType" is an abstract type for encoding the graphical
        properties used to portray geographic information.  Concrete Symbolizer
        types are derived from this base type.
      
		
		
			
			
			
		
		
		
	
	
		
			
        A "BaseSymbolizer" defines the default properties of a Symbolizer to
        be those of an external Symbolizer, which will frequently be inside
        of an OGC Symbolizer repository.  The Symbolizer properties given
        in-line override the base-Symbolizer properties.
      
		
	
	
		
			
		
	
	
	
		
      LINE Symbolizer
    
	
	
		
			
        A LineSymbolizer is used to render a "stroke" along a linear geometry.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
					
					
					
				
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A Geometry gives reference to a (the) geometry property of a
        feature to be used for rendering.
      
		
	
	
		
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"Stroke" specifies the appearance of a linear geometry.  It is
        defined in parallel with SVG strokes.  The following SvgParameters
        may be used: "stroke" (color), "stroke-opacity", "stroke-width",
        "stroke-linejoin", "stroke-linecap", "stroke-dasharray", and
        "stroke-dashoffset".  Others are not officially supported.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
				
			
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"SvgParameter" refers to an SVG/CSS graphical-formatting
        parameter.  The parameter is identified using the "name" attribute
        and the content of the element gives the SVG/CSS-coded value.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
			
		
	
	
		
			
        The "ParameterValueType" uses WFS-Filter expressions to give
        values for SE graphic parameters.  A "mixed" element-content
        model is used with textual substitution for values.
      
		
		
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"GraphicFill" defines repeated-graphic filling (stippling)
        pattern for an area geometry.
      
		
	
	
		
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"GraphicStroke" defines a repeated-linear graphic pattern to be used
        for stroking a line.
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
			
		
	
	
		
			
       Initialgap defines the initial empty space, before the first Graphic or Label should be rendered.
    
		
	
	
		
			
      Gap defines the empty space between two Graphics or Labels.
    
		
	
	
	
		
      POLYGON Symbolizer
    
	
	
		
			
        A "PolygonSymbolizer" specifies the rendering of a polygon or
        area geometry, including its interior fill and border stroke.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
					
					
					
					
					
				
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"Fill" specifies the pattern for filling an area geometry.
        The allowed SvgParameters are: "fill" (color) and "fill-opacity".
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
		
	
	
	
		
      POINT Symbolizer
    
	
	
		
			
        A "PointSymbolizer" specifies the rendering of a "graphic Symbolizer"
        at a point.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
					
					
				
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"Graphic" specifies or refers to a "graphic Symbolizer" with inherent
        shape, size, and coloring.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
				
			
			
			
			
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
	
		
			
        An "ExternalGraphic" gives a reference to a raster or vector
        graphical object, either online or inline, in an externally-defined
        graphic format.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
				
			
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
	
		
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"Mark" specifies a geometric shape and applies coloring to it.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
				
					
						
						
					
					
					
				
			
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
	
		
      TEXT Symbolizer
    
	
	
		
			
        A "TextSymbolizer" is used to render text labels according to
        various graphical parameters.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
					
					
					
					
					
					
				
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"Label" specifies the textual content to be rendered.
      
		
	
	
		
			
        A "Font" element specifies the text font to use.  The allowed
        SvgParameters are: "font-family", "font-style", "font-weight",
        and "font-size".
      
		
	
	
		
			
		
	
	
		
			
        The "LabelPlacement" specifies where and how a text label should
        be rendered relative to a geometry.  The present mechanism is
        poorly aligned with CSS/SVG.
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"PointPlacement" specifies how a text label should be rendered
        relative to a geometric point.
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
			
		
	
	
		
			
        An "AnchorPoint" identifies the location inside of a text label to
        use an an 'anchor' for positioning it relative to a point geometry.
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
		
			
        A "Displacement" gives X and Y offset displacements to use for
        rendering a text label, graphic or other Symbolizernear a point.
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
		
			
        A "LinePlacement" specifies how a text label should be rendered
        relative to a linear geometry.
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
			
			
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
	
		
			
        A "PerpendicularOffset" gives the perpendicular distance away
        from a line to draw a label.
      
		
	
	
		
			
        A "Halo" fills an extended area outside the glyphs of a rendered
        text label to make the label easier to read over a background.
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
		
      RASTER Symbolizer
    
	
	
		
			
        A "RasterSymbolizer" is used to specify the rendering of
        raster/matrix-coverage data (e.g., satellite images, DEMs).
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
					
					
					
					
					
					
					
					
				
			
		
	
	
		
			
        "ChannelSelection" specifies the false-color channel selection
        for a multi-spectral raster source.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
				
				
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
	
	
		
			
			
		
	
	
	
		
			
        "OverlapBehavior" tells a system how to behave when multiple
        raster images in a layer overlap each other, for example with
        satellite-image scenes.
      
		
		
			
				
				
				
				
			
		
	
	
		
			
        A "ColorMap" defines either the colors of a pallette-type raster
        source or the mapping of numeric pixel values to colors.
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
		
	
	
		
			
        "ContrastEnhancement" defines the 'stretching' of contrast for a
        channel of a false-color image or for a whole grey/color image.
        Contrast enhancement is used to make ground features in images
        more visible.
      
		
	
	
		
			
				
				
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
	
	
	
	
	
		
			
        "ShadedRelief" specifies the application of relief shading
        (or "hill shading") to a DEM raster to give it somewhat of a
        three-dimensional effect and to make elevation changes more
        visible.
      
		
	
	
		
			
			
		
	
	
	
	
		
			
        "ImageOutline" specifies how individual source rasters in
        a multi-raster set (such as a set of satellite-image scenes)
        should be outlined to make the individual-image locations visible.
